Materials You’ll Need 🧶

You really don’t need much to bring this sweet flower bag to life. I used a soft cotton yarn, but seriously—whatever you’ve got stashed away will do. 🙃

  • Worsted-weight cotton yarn (yellow for center, white for petals, and a base color of your choice!)
  • 3.5mm or 4mm crochet hook
  • Scissors
  • Yarn needle for weaving in ends
  • Stitch markers (optional, but helpful!)
  • Drawstring cord or chain of your choice

Techniques Used – Don’t Worry, It’s Easy! 🧵

I promise, everything here is beginner-friendly! We’re keeping it simple but delightful. 🌸

  • Slip stitch (sl st): To join and create smooth edging.
  • Single crochet (sc): The basic building block of your pouch—easy and versatile.
  • Magic ring: The starting trick to make your daisy flower look neat and round.
  • Double crochet (dc): Great for those lovely petals!

Hand-Trendy Pro Tips ✨

Let’s talk little hacks for big joy. My first attempt honestly came out a little wonky (hello uneven petals 😂), but that’s how we learn, right?

  • ✨ When making the daisy flower, make sure your tension is loose—too tight and the petals won’t bloom.
  • 🧵 Stitch markers are your BFF for keeping track of rounds, especially when shaping the pouch base.
  • 🌈 Don’t be afraid to mix colors! Pastels are dreamy, but rainbow petal versions turn out SO cute!
